Product Description

by Stephanie O'Connor (Author)

Every county has its good and evil spirits, and in Ireland, it's the leprechaun. Strange mischievous little men who put superstitious fear into everyone's heart - whether good or bad. But, of all of the little men, past, present, and future, who terrorise the beautiful green fields of Ireland, Toolis O'Shaughnessy was the most legendary.

Categorised under "JUVENILE FICTION / Holidays & Celebrations / St. Patrick's Day," The Leprechaun's Handbook and Stories book is the perfect St. Patrick's Day read for kids, offering fun Irish folklore and stories from the life of Toolis O'Shaughnessy. In addition to Toolis's own writings, stories in this book were told by people who knew him and relatives of the people in the stories - kindly handed down through generations so that those who are unaware of Ireland's rich history of fairy lore can gain benefit.

Categorised under "JUVENILE NONFICTION / People & Places / Europe," this book also explores the cultural aspects of Ireland, providing insight into the myths and legends that have shaped its history. For those intrigued by the world of leprechauns, categorised under "FICTION / Fairy Tales, Folk Tales, Legends & Mythology," it offers steps and tips on becoming a leprechaun, making it an engaging read for those aspiring to join the ranks of these mythical beings. And for young readers interested in the magic of St. Patrick's Day, this book provides a delightful journey into Irish folklore and traditions, making it an educational and entertaining choice.
